Who we are:

Jigsaw Homes Group is one of the largest housing groups in England with more than 37,500 homes across the North West and East Midlands.

We provide quality, low-cost housing and play a wider role in making sure our residents thrive in their homes and benefit from living in healthy, sustainable communities.

Role information:

Working as part of the Estates Services team based in Tameside within our Housing for Over 55s schemes, you will carry out general cleaning of communal areas, preparing guest rooms and bedding for visiting customers, ordering stock and carrying out stock checks.

Your ability to get things done quickly and efficiently will help us create clean, safe and attractive environments where our customers can call home.

You will ideally have a reasonable standard level of literacy and numeracy skills to be able to interpret and comply with risk assessments.

You will be able to work independently and with onsite support staff from our Housing for Over 55s team.

You will be committed to providing excellent customer service and ensuring high levels of cleanliness and hygiene are maintained.

Onsite training and equipment will be provided to help you to work successfully.
